"The Gift Bag Chronicles" continues the outrageous misadventures of Hollywood girl-about-town Alex Davidson, who has moved up the ladder at her firm - formerly a mere publicist, she's now the head of 'event planning' division, which means she's a party planner. And what goes on behind the scenes while the real stars (and the plastic-surgeons who want to be treated like real stars) sip champagne, makes for the funniest, zingiest, sexiest story yet.
Narrator Laura Hamilton accurately skewers the essence of the L.A. party scene, where making the gossip columns is mandatory, and the bling in the gift bags is more important than the booze. Alex Davidson, head of event planning for a high-end PR firm, is swamped by demanding, sometimes demented, clients, not-to-be-trusted co-workers, and an East Coast boyfriend who can't seem to commit. With the biggest blast of the season looming, Alex is forced to take a hard look at her life. Hamilton chronicles party power in Tinsel Town with hilarious results, keeps up with the lightening-paced events, and infuses each character with a distinctive voice. M.T.B.
